Kunanposhpora rape victims’ statements recorded in court

Srinagar, May 25, 2013 (PPI-OT): In occupied Kashmir, a court in Kupwara recorded the statements of five victims of the mass rape that took place in Kunanposhpora area of the Kupwara district in 1990.The statements were recorded by the court following directives from the High Court of occupied Kashmir on May 14 to expedite proceedings in the 23-year-old case, in which Indian troops were involved.

On May 14, the High Court disposed a Public Interest Litigation (PIL) on the Kunanposhpora mass rape case holding that it would be premature for it to intervene as the case is pending before the Sessions Court in Kupwara.

The Jammu and Kashmir Coalition of Civil Society, a human rights group, had filed the PIL through Pervaiz Imroz on behalf of 50 victims of the mass rape.

Meanwhile, Khurram Pervez, expressed surprise that the statements of victims were recorded in an open court in contravention to the Indian Supreme Court guidelines on protecting the identity of the rape victims. He said, the JKCCS would explore legal avenues on protecting the identity of other victims scheduled to depose before the court on June 10.
